Two UK restaurant chains are closing dozens of branches, leading to hundreds of job losses in another blow to the British high street.

Franco Manca will close 16 branches (nine in London) and The Real Greek will shut nine restaurants, resulting in 376 combined job losses, after Fulham Shore sold 19 of The Real Greek's 28 branches to The Karali Group and secured creditor approval for Franco Manca's CVA restructuring.
